Transaction 995257611d64c38e9f2124eef7532250380378bbfa951b77729295e7ca54c830

1 Input
2 Outputs
  • 995257611d64c38e9f2124eef7532250380378bbfa951b77729295e7ca54c830:0
  • value  174199662
    address  17sAFRFvZwW57zBDnmqk6VnDVg8gZqPAy3
  • 995257611d64c38e9f2124eef7532250380378bbfa951b77729295e7ca54c830:1
  • value  300000000
    address  34EDFyDMmGrqDmCoKgzAiwYbxoWn4ckWhL